@charset "UTF-8";:root{--black: #0d0d0d;--dark: #1a1a1a;--muted: #888;--light: #f5f3f0;--white: #fff;--accent: #C8781A;--accent2: #a55e10;--max: 1120px;--r: 1rem}*,*:before,*:after{box-sizing:border-box}html{scroll-behavior:smooth}html,body{margin:0;padding:0;box-sizing:border-box;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.cdk-overlay-pane{z-index:1000!important}.mat-datepicker-content{background:#fff!important;opacity:1!important;box-shadow:0 12px 30px #00000040!important;border-radius:12px!important;padding:6px!important}.mat-calendar{background:#fff!important}.mat-mdc-dialog-surface,.mat-datepicker-content .mat-mdc-dialog-surface{background:#fff!important;opacity:1!important}.mat-datepicker-content{border:1px solid rgba(0,0,0,.12)}.mat-calendar-body-disabled .mat-calendar-body-cell-content{background:#0000000d!important;color:#00000047!important;opacity:1!important;position:relative}.mat-calendar-body-disabled .mat-calendar-body-cell-content:after{content:"";position:absolute;left:18%;right:18%;top:50%;height:2px;background:#0000002e;transform:rotate(-18deg)}.mat-calendar-body-disabled:hover .mat-calendar-body-cell-content{background:#f3f4f6!important;cursor:not-allowed}.mat-calendar-previous-button[disabled],.mat-calendar-next-button[disabled]{opacity:.3!important}.mat-calendar-body-today:not(.mat-calendar-body-disabled) .mat-calendar-body-cell-content{border:1px solid #1976d2!important}.mat-calendar-previous-button,.mat-calendar-next-button{opacity:1!important;color:#000!important}.mat-calendar-previous-button:hover,.mat-calendar-next-button:hover{background:#0000000f!important;border-radius:50%}.mat-calendar-previous-button[disabled],.mat-calendar-next-button[disabled]{opacity:.25!important;cursor:not-allowed}.toast-success .mdc-snackbar__surface{background:#1e6b3a!important;border-left:4px solid #4caf50;border-radius:.75rem!important;box-shadow:0 8px 28px #00000038!important}.toast-success .mdc-snackbar__label{color:#fff!important;font-family:Inter,system-ui,sans-serif;font-size:.92rem;font-weight:500}.toast-success .mdc-button__label{color:#a5d6a7!important;font-weight:700;font-size:.82rem}.toast-error .mdc-snackbar__surface{background:#7f1d1d!important;border-left:4px solid #ef5350;border-radius:.75rem!important;box-shadow:0 8px 28px #00000038!important}.toast-error .mdc-snackbar__label{color:#fff!important;font-family:Inter,system-ui,sans-serif;font-size:.92rem;font-weight:500}.toast-error .mdc-button__label{color:#ffcdd2!important;font-weight:700;font-size:.82rem}
